CYCLOSORUS FUKIENENSIS CHING (THELYPTERIDACEAE): A NEW RECORD FOR THE FLORA OF VIETNAM

Cyclosorus fukienensis Ching (Thelypteridaceae), a new record for the flora of Vietnam, was studied, compared and described. Before, this species only distributed in China (Fujian, North Guangdong, South Hunan, South Jiangxi, South Zhejiang). This species differs from the closely related species Cyclosorus interruptus (Willd.) H. Itô and Cyclosorus acuminatus (Houtt.) Nakai in its shape of the stipe bases, lobed, veinlets, soris, spores. In this paper, we introduce original reference and relevant references, type, detail morphological descriptions, distribution and habitat, specimens examined, color photograph, the key and the table compares the characteristics with the close species (Cyclosorus interruptus (Willd.) H. Itô, Cyclosorus acuminatus (Houtt.) Nakai). Specimens of Cyclosorus fukienensis Ching were collected in Kbang district, Gia Lai province and kept in the Herbarium of the Institute of Ecology and Biological Resources, Hanoi, Vietnam (HN). This research provides the checklist of vascular plants for the flora of Viet Nam.
